Key Events

Get ready for a thrilling journey across continents as IEM 2026 brings Counter-Strike 2 action to Brazil, the US, and China. These major tournaments will serve as the pinnacle of competitive CS2 in 2026, attracting the world’s best teams and captivating fans worldwide.
- IEM Brazil 2026: The electrifying atmosphere of Brazilian esports will be on full display as IEM lands in the heart of South America. Expect passionate crowds, fierce competition, and a showcase of Counter-Strike 2’s global appeal.
- IEM North America 2026: The US will once again be a hub for CS2 excellence. IEM North America 2026 promises to be a battleground for North American supremacy, with top teams vying for glory on home soil.
- IEM China 2026: The burgeoning CS2 scene in China will take center stage at IEM China 2026. This event will be a momentous occasion for Chinese esports, providing a platform for local talent to shine on an international stage.
These three major IEM tournaments will be the highlight of the 2026 CS2 calendar, offering a thrilling spectacle of skill, strategy, and competitive intensity.
